Abu Simbel: A Morning of Marvels

Your adventure kicks off at 4:00 am with a pickup from your hotel or the airport. The early start might seem ambitious, but it’s essential for catching Abu Simbel at sunrise, an experience described by travelers as unforgettable. The temple was carved by Ramses II, and its alignment with the sun twice a year makes it a stunning spectacle.

Aswan Highlights: Obelisk, High Dam, and Philae Temple

Back in Aswan, you’ll visit key modern and ancient landmarks: the Unfinished Obelisk, which reveals insights into ancient stone-carving techniques; the High Dam, symbolizing modern engineering; and Philae Temple, dedicated to Isis, where the guide’s stories bring the site to life.

Day Two: Luxor’s Temples and Tombs

The second day begins early when your guide picks you up from the hotel in Aswan for the drive to Luxor. The journey itself is scenic, making the commute part of the experience.

In Luxor, you’ll explore the East Bank with the Karnak Temple, the largest religious complex in the world, and the Luxor Temple, with its grand pylons and sacred statues. Expect to be wowed by the scale and preservation of these ancient structures.

After lunch, the focus shifts to the West Bank, home to the Valley of the Kings, where the tombs of pharaohs like Tutankhamun are hidden deep underground. The Queen Hatshepsut Temple offers a striking blend of natural cliff backdrop and artistic grandeur.
